Mesothelioma Compensation

The costs associated with mesothelioma can add up quickly. Compensation from a lawsuit trust fund or VA benefits can help offset costs.

A top mesothelioma lawyer firm can review your work and military history to determine the date and time when asbestos exposure most likely occurred. They can also explain the different types of compensation.

How Much Money Will I Receive?

Asbestos victims can be compensated for future and past medical expenses and lost wages, as well as suffering and pain, and other damages. The amount awarded is contingent on the individual circumstances. Patients with mesothelioma could also be entitled to punitive damages. These are additional payments made to punish defendants.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will help clients determine whether the option of a trial or settlement is best for them.

An experienced attorney can help clients get the most amount of compensation possible. Attorneys cannot guarantee a certain amount of compensation. There are many variables to consider in the process, including the victim's unique mesothelioma type and how long they have been diagnosed with the disease. The compensation received can also be affected by the number of asbestos companies who are accountable.

The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its are settled instead of going to trial. A case can take many years to be heard. A trial allows a jury to determine if defendants owe victims compensation and how much money they owe.

Veterans Affairs provides benefits to victims of mesothelioma and asbestos-related diseases in addition to monetary compensation. These benefits could include access to top mesothelioma experts and disability compensation. Veterans can seek help from a lawyer with their VA claims.

A veteran's lawyer can also help them file personal injury lawsuits against asbestos-related companies who are responsible for mesothelioma or other diseases. However, a mesothelioma lawsuit is not a substitute for filing an VA claim.

What compensation is available?

Mesothelioma compensation can cover a wide range of costs. Compensation can cover medical bills as well as lost wages and expenses for home care. It can also cover other losses that are not tangible, such as discomfort and pain. Mesothelioma lawyers may be able to assist in calculating the amount of compensation you will receive.

The most common asbestos claims are personal injury and wrongful death lawsuits. A top mesothelioma lawyer can examine your case for free and suggest the most appropriate type of compensation claim to make. They will gather evidence, including your history of work and exposure to asbestos dates. They will also have access to huge databases of asbestos-producing companies.

As the dangers of asbestos became widely known, many companies that made asbestos compensation-containing products filed for bankruptcy. These companies created asbestos trust funds to ensure that their victims were compensated. They are estimated to contain $30 billion and are used to pay mesothelioma victims without the need to go to court. On average, mesothelioma compensation amounts and jury verdicts are more than asbestos trust fund payments.

Certain victims and their families may be eligible for financial aid through government programs in addition to suing, or establishing an asbestos trust fund. Veterans who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ease can receive disability benefits through the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s. This compensation is based on the severity of mesothelioma, or any other asbestos attorney-related disease.

Families of mesothelioma patients may also be eligible for compensation for wrongful deaths or estate claims. Asbestos-related victims could also be eligible for community assistance or other benefits from their employer or the military.
